CHI St. Francis Health Staff Provides Blankets for Hospice Comfort

The contribution of more than 35 blankets from staff of CHI St. Francis Health is helping to maintain a tradition at CHI Health at Home-Hospice in Breckenridge, MN. Each person admitted to hospice care receives a handmade fleece comfort blanket that their family, in turn, gets to keep.

During National Hospital and Nursing Home Week in May, the CHI St. Francis Health staff contributed material for 35 blankets, as well the time needed to make them. Because CHI Health at Home-Hospice provide cares to about 100 people during the course of a year, lots of blankets are needed to continue the tradition. The family members of hospice patients often comment on how comforted they are by the blankets they receive after a loved one has passed away.
